My capital gain distributions on a brokerage tax reporting statement do not appear to be shown in Turbotax under income. Where would they be shown?

They get input on your dividend screen, but capital gains distributions show up on line 13 of your Form 1040 or line 10 of your Form 1040A.

To look at your form:

1. Go to Tax Tools on the left-hand side.

2. Go to Tools.

3. Go to View Tax Summary.

4. Click Preview my 1040 from the left-hand side.
